编程有什么课程可以上

fiy 其他 2

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程是一个广泛而深入的领域,学习编程需要有系统的课程来指导和培养。下面是一些常见的编程课程可供选择:

    1. C++编程课程:C++是一种常用的编程语言,它是以C语言为基础,并且增加了面向对象的特性。学习C++可以帮助你理解底层的计算机原理,同时也是很多大型软件和游戏开发的基础。C++编程课程通常包括基础语法、面向对象编程、数据结构与算法等内容。

    2. Python编程课程:Python是一种易学易用的编程语言,广泛应用于各个领域,如数据分析、人工智能、Web开发等。学习Python可以让你快速上手编程,并且拥有丰富的库和框架来支持各种应用开发。Python编程课程通常包括基础语法、数据结构、函数和模块、Web开发等内容。

    3. Java编程课程:Java是一种跨平台的编程语言,广泛应用于企业级应用开发和移动应用开发。学习Java可以让你具备独立开发大型软件的能力,并且拥有丰富的开发工具和框架来支持各种应用开发。Java编程课程通常包括基础语法、面向对象编程、数据库操作、GUI开发等内容。

    4. Web开发课程:Web开发是一种构建和维护网站和Web应用程序的技术。学习Web开发可以让你理解前端和后端的工作原理,并且掌握常用的Web开发技术和工具。Web开发课程通常包括HTML/CSS、JavaScript、PHP/Python/Ruby等服务器端语言、数据库操作等内容。

    5. 数据科学与机器学习课程:数据科学和机器学习是当前热门的领域,通过分析和挖掘大量数据来获取有用的信息和模式。学习数据科学和机器学习可以让你具备数据分析和预测建模的能力,并且掌握常用的数据科学和机器学习算法和工具。这类课程通常包括统计学基础、数据清洗和预处理、机器学习算法、数据可视化等内容。

    除了以上提到的课程,还有很多其他的编程课程可供选择,如移动应用开发、游戏开发、网络安全等等。根据自己的兴趣和需求选择适合自己的课程,通过系统学习和实践来提升编程能力。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程是一门广泛涉及各种技术和领域的学科,因此有很多不同类型的编程课程可供学习。以下是几个常见的编程课程:

    1. 计算机科学基础课程:这些课程通常是大学本科计算机科学专业的必修课程,涵盖计算机科学的基本原理和概念,如数据结构、算法设计、计算机体系结构等。这些课程旨在帮助学生建立坚实的计算机科学基础,为进一步学习更高级的编程课程奠定基础。

    2. 编程语言课程:这些课程主要教授不同编程语言的基本语法和用法,如Java、Python、C++等。学生通过实践编写代码来学习如何使用这些语言进行程序设计和开发。这些课程通常包括课堂讲座、实验和项目作业,以帮助学生培养编程技能。

    3. 网络编程课程:这些课程教授如何使用编程语言开发网络应用程序和服务。学生将学习TCP/IP协议、HTTP协议、Socket编程等网络编程的基本原理和技术,以及使用不同网络框架和库进行开发的实践。

    4. 数据库课程:这些课程专注于数据库的设计、管理和查询技术。学生将学习关系数据库的概念、SQL语言的基本语法、数据库设计方法等,并通过实际案例来实践使用数据库进行数据管理和查询。

    5.移动应用开发课程:这些课程教授如何使用特定的开发工具和技术来创建移动应用程序,如Android开发、iOS开发等。学生将学习移动应用开发的基本原理和技术,了解用户界面设计、应用调试、发布到应用商店等方面的知识。

    此外,还有许多其他专业课程,如人工智能、机器学习、数据科学等,这些课程使用编程作为工具,教授与相关领域相关的编程技术和算法。想要学习编程,可以根据自己的兴趣和需求,选择适合自己的课程。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程是一门技术性很强的学科,有许多课程可以帮助学习者掌握编程技能。以下是一些常见的可供选择的编程课程:

    1. 入门级编程课程:适合初学者,介绍基本的编程概念和技术。这类课程通常会涵盖编程语言的基础知识,如Python、Java或C++等。

    2. Web开发课程:着眼于开发网站和Web应用程序所需的技术和工具。这种课程通常包括HTML、CSS、JavaScript和后端开发框架等。

    3. 移动应用开发课程:专注于开发移动应用程序所需的技术和工具。这类课程通常会涉及iOS开发(使用Swift或Objective-C)或安卓开发(使用Java或Kotlin)等。

    4. 数据科学和机器学习课程:介绍用于处理和分析数据的编程语言和工具,如Python和R。这类课程还会涉及机器学习和人工智能的基本原理和应用。

    5. 游戏开发课程:介绍创建电子游戏所需的技术和工具,如游戏引擎和编程语言(如Unity和C#)。

    6. 算法和数据结构课程:重点讲解算法和数据结构的基本知识,这对于解决复杂问题和优化代码非常重要。

    7. 网络安全课程:专注于网络和信息安全的原理和技术,帮助学习者了解网络攻击和防御的基本概念。

    以上只是一些常见的编程课程,实际上还有很多其他特定领域的课程,如人工智能、区块链、云计算等。学习者可以根据自己的兴趣和目标选择适合自己的课程。此外,还可以通过在线学习平台、大学或学院提供的课程、教程和培训班来学习编程。无论选择哪种途径,重要的是保持学习和实践的态度,并不断提升自己的编程技能。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部